The Mars 2013 Cask 1706 is a single cask single malt from Mars Shinshu, Hombo Shuzo's distillery in Miyada, Nagano, filling and maturing in an American White Oak cask before bottling in 2016 at the natural cask strength of 55%. The Japanese market release is one of several single cask expressions from the 2013 vintage, each isolating a specific cask's contribution to the clean mountain character of the site.
Three years in American White Oak at the cool, stable temperatures of the Central Alps typically yields a fresh, vanilla-forward spirit with gentle cereal and resinous wood notes. At 55%, the whisky has moderate intensity for a cask strength bottling, giving it a slightly more integrated texture than the higher-proof expressions from the same period. The absence of specific flavour notes for this cask means the profile is inferred from the house pattern: clean, lightly sweet and wood-forward.
